There is a legal obligation for all Local Authorities to hold meetings. The Local Government Act 2001 stipulated the updated requirements surrounding the holding and composition of meetings. The meetings are as a rule held in the County Chamber in the County Hall, Riverside , Sligo.
The Cathaoirleach and Leas Cathaoirleach are elected by the members at the Council Annual General Meeting normally held in July
